摘要

在机载软件架构设计阶段,人们将安全性研制保证水平分配到具体的构件中,确保产品质量。鉴于现代航空软件系统极其复杂,如何从系统角度,检验分配给构件的安全性等级符合系统的一致性目标,是设计阶段需要解决的重要问题。首先,分析了分布式和综合式机载软件系统的架构特点,得出了在安全性分析工作中需要考虑冗余等架构设计的影响的结论。其次,使用系统建模语言(SysML)块图建立带有安全性等级属性的系统静态结构模型,利用矩阵对模型进行精确的形式化转换;制定验证规则,在此基础上给出了验证方法,以验证安全性等级分配的合理性。在验证过程中,将关键信息存储在XML文档中,可为适航性审查提供证据。最后,通过实例分析,验证了该...

  • 出版日期2014-9-23
  • 单位空军工程大学航空航天工程学院